A man has appeared in court charged with deliberately setting a fire after a blaze at a business park in Inverness.

A car was allegedly driven into a premises at Fairways Business Park shortly before midnight on March 8, before the building and car were set alight.

Two men, aged 34 and 38, were charged in connection with the incident.

Jack Ventham appeared at Inverness Sheriff Court on Monday charged with wilful fire-raising and knowingly possessing stolen property.

The 34-year-old, from Livingston, made no plea during his appearance and was remanded in custody.

He was committed for further examination and is due to appear again within eight days.
